After menopause, weight loss can be achieved through adjusting dietary structure, regular exercise, psychological adjustment, traditional Chinese medicine regulation, and medication assistance. After menopause, estrogen levels decrease, metabolic rate decreases, and fat accumulation is more likely to occur.

1. Adjust dietary structure
Reduce intake of refined carbohydrates and saturated fats, increase high-quality protein and dietary fiber. Daily staple foods can include coarse grains such as oats and brown rice, paired with dark vegetables such as broccoli and spinach. Moderate consumption of low-fat and high protein foods such as salmon and chicken breast, avoiding fried foods and desserts. Pay attention to controlling total calorie intake and maintain a regular three meal diet.
2. Regular Exercise
It is recommended to engage in 150 minutes of moderate intensity aerobic exercise per week, such as brisk walking, swimming, or cycling. It can be combined with resistance training, 2-3 times a week for 20-30 minutes each time, using elastic bands or small dumbbells to exercise the main muscle groups. Warm up and stretch before and after exercise, gradually increasing the intensity. Water sports have low joint pressure and are suitable for overweight individuals.
3. Psychological adjustment
Menopausal emotional fluctuations may affect weight loss outcomes, and stress can be relieved through mindfulness meditation and deep breathing exercises. Establish a weight loss diary to record diet and exercise, and set reasonable goals. Participate in social activities or interest groups to gain support from family and friends. Ensure sufficient sleep, 7-8 hours a day, and avoid staying up late.

5. Medication Assistance
Severe obesity can be treated with medication such as Orlistat capsules according to medical advice, and should be accompanied by diet and exercise. Hormone replacement therapy needs to be evaluated by a specialist before use. Avoid taking weight loss tea or laxatives on your own. Regularly monitor changes in weight, waist circumference, and body fat percentage, and recheck liver and kidney function if necessary.

Weight loss after menopause should be maintained for a long time to avoid rapid weight loss. Drink 1500-2000 milliliters of water daily, choose stairs instead of elevators to increase daily activity. Cooking is done using steaming and boiling methods to reduce dining out. Regularly conduct bone density checks to prevent osteoporosis. If you experience palpitations, dizziness, or other discomfort, seek medical attention promptly and do not excessively diet.
